FAQ
Is pyhuge pure Python?
Yes. pyhuge is native Python and does not require rpy2. The mb/glasso/tiger estimators require the bundled C++ extension (built automatically on install).

Which method should I start with?
Use method="mb" first. Then compare with method="glasso".
Difference between fit.path and sel.refit?
fit.path: full path of estimated graphssel.refit: single selected graph under criterion (ric,stars,ebic)
Which selection criterion should I use?
ric: fast and simplestars: stability-focused, slower; currently for MB, CT, and glassoebic: common for glasso
Use ric for TIGER. StARS is rejected for TIGER until all subsample fits can
report a common certified lambda-path prefix.

Can input be covariance/correlation matrix?
Yes. For ct, glasso, and tiger, huge(...) accepts square
covariance/correlation input. For mb, use a raw data matrix (n x d).
The compatible default input_type="auto" detects covariance input by
symmetry. If observations happen to form a square symmetric matrix, pass
input_type="data" explicitly; use "covariance" to require covariance
routing and validation.
For glasso without an explicit lambda, "auto" matches R's historical
diagonal-sensitive default scale, while "covariance" uses only
off-diagonal entries. CT and TIGER require a positive-semidefinite covariance
matrix. Glasso may accept an indefinite pairwise estimate only when its
regularized covariance/precision result passes native certification.
Is there a built-in dataset?
Yes:
from pyhuge import huge_stockdata
stock = huge_stockdata()
print(stock.data.shape, stock.info.shape)
